As the sun began to rise over the scenic coastal city of Itajaí, Brazil, the air buzzed with anticipation. Families packed their bags, students pulled on their T-shirts, and pastors gathered their flocks. It was a time of unity, faith, and action; the 24th Convention of Missions was set to welcome 100,000 attendees from across the globe. This congregation aimed not only to worship but also to ignite a renewed passion for missions and outreach in an ever-changing world.

The event, organized by the Brazilian Missions Movement (Movimento Evangélico de Missões, or Mevam), will unfold from June 15 to June 18, 2026. With registration exceeding all expectations, the gathering has attracted not just Brazilian Christians but individuals representing various nationalities, united under the banner of faith. "This convention will be a vibrant explosion of worship, teaching, and going forth into the world to make disciples," said one of the organizers, eager to emphasize the mission's global significance.

Pastor Laerte Moura, who has been part of the organizing team since the first convention, recalled how far they have come since those initial gatherings. “It’s incredible to see how God has expanded our vision and our impact. From a small group of dedicated followers to nearly a hundred thousand passionate believers. We believe it is our time to send many of these warriors out into the fields of harvest,” he remarked with sparkles of hope in his eyes.

Moreover, the Convention has not only become an epicenter for spiritual engagement, but it has also evolved into an opportunity for fellowship, education, and empowerment. Throughout the four-day event, workshops, seminars, and ministry opportunities will flourish. Dr. Ricardo Silva, a renowned theologian and missionary, will host discussions on the practicalities of global missions and the theological foundations of evangelism. "We need Christians everywhere, not just in our churches," he asserted, urging attendees to see their workplaces as mission fields.
